Prijenos i učitavanje XML podataka 8.3 upute. Formiranje dokumenta "faktura"

2018-11-15T19: 32: 35 + 00: 00

Univerzalna obrada "Istovar i preuzimanje podataka XML" čini potpunu ili djelomičnu istovar podataka podataka o podacima u XML datoteku. Nakon toga, ova datoteka se može učitati u informatičku bazu koristeći istu obradu. Format istovara datoteke razlikuje se od format datoteke kreiran prilikom istovara u skladu s planom razmjene, dio zaglavlja.

Obrada se može koristiti samo u slučajevima kada su podaci u kojoj se podaci istovaruju i podaci u kojima se učitavaju podaci su homogeni (konfiguracije su identične, podaci mogu varirati) ili su svi istovareni objekti gotovo u potpunosti u kompoziciji i Vrste detalja i tabelarni dijelovi, svojstva "Master" objekta metapodataka i tako dalje.

Korištenje ove obrade moguće je, na primjer, stvoriti potpunu ili djelomičnu sigurnosna kopija podaci, izrađujući razmjenu podataka između informativne baze, kao i kao pomoćni alat prilikom vraćanja neuspjelih baza podataka.

Obrada podržava istovar podataka s mogućnošću postavljanja odabira po periodu. Također implementirao provjeru objekata za nevažeće simbole prilikom razmjene putem XML-a.

Pozdravi, (nastavnik i programer).

Uprkos činjenici da je 1c najpopularniji, praktičniji i pouzdaniji informacioni sistemImati niz rješenja u svom vladaru da se automatski automatski obrađuje i obrađuju sve poslovne procese u preduzećima bilo kojeg obima i oblasti aktivnosti, korisnici imaju dnevnu potrebu za istovaranjem podataka iz 1C programi treće strane ili datoteke. U ovom članku razmislite o tome što istovari iz 1c i pokaži kako istovari od 1c i koji se mogu pojaviti problemi.

Podaci koji se mogu istovariti sa 1c

1C Svaka konfiguracija Regular podržava istovar takvih podataka kao:

  • Štampani oblici;
  • Izvještaji;
  • Tabele i liste.

Prijenos podataka iz 1C 8.3 mogući su u mnogim popularnim formatima:

Istovar ispisanih oblika i izvještaja

Svaki obrazac za ispis ili izvještaj u 1C-u može se sačuvati u željenom formatu. Da biste to učinili, morat ćete otvoriti obrazac ili izveštaj, a zatim odaberite u glavnom meniju Datoteka - Spremi kao.

Nakon toga otvorit će se prozor za uštedu datoteka, što označava ime i vrstu datoteke:



Mogući problemi prilikom istovara sa 1c


To je zbog činjenice da se štampani oblik ili izvještaj ne aktivira ovaj trenutak. Tako da je tiskani obrazac postao dostupan za uštedu, potrebno je jednostavno kliknuti mišem na bilo kojem mjestu na njemu:


Istovar u Excel

Podaci o obradi u najpopularniji tabelarni format zahtijeva odgovarajuće istovar. Da biste spremili željene podatke u Excel formatu, morate odrediti vrstu u dijaloškom okviru za uštedu datoteka Excel list2007 --... (*. XLSX). Manje često, morate spremiti podatke u starom formatu Excel lima (* .xls):


Slično tome, odabirom željenog formata, možete istovarati iz 1C u PDF-u, od 1c u Wordu, od 1C do CSV-a, kao i na druge formate.

Istovar proizvoljnih stolova sa 1c

U ovaj odjeljak Pokazat će se kako se bilo koji podaci mogu istovariti, pod uvjetom da imate pravo na njega.

U 1C je razvijen redovan mehanizam koji vam omogućava da se istovarite bilo koji list (na primjer, popis dokumenata ili referentnih stavki). Da biste to učinili, na komandnom panelu bilo koje liste u grupi "Ipak" Dostupan tim "Lista":



Informacije će biti prikazane u posebnom tabelarnom dokumentu. Ovaj dokument izgleda isto kao i bilo koji drugi izvještaj u 1c, a može se istovarati na isti način korištenjem naredbe. Datoteka - Spremi kao:



Kako istovariti podatke koji nisu vidljivi na popisu

Često, problem istovara popisa koji je nastao prati potrebu za dodavanjem zvučnika tamo, koji su tačno u dokumentu (imenik), ali iz nekog razloga nisu vidljivi na trenutnom popisu. Primjer: Dodaj na popis "klijenata" da biste istovarili polje "Telefon", koji se prikazuje samo na dodatnom panelu s desne strane:


Dakle, da se telefon može istovariti iz 1C, još je potrebno da ga dodate na popis. Da biste to učinili, morate nazvati tim "Više - Promenite obrazac." Dalje, moramo pronaći željenu listu zvučnika. Postoji jedan trik: programeri tipičnih konfiguracija gotovo uvijek dodaju polje "Veza". Ako ustanete na to, a zatim kliknite gumb Da ćemo vidjeti sva moguća polja ove referentne knjige. Pronađite polje "Telefon" I stavljamo krpelj korišćenja.



Nakon toga, baza podataka s klijentima s telefonima može se istovariti u datoteku kroz redovnu naredbu. "Lista" i prodajte konkurente.

Vjerovatno je svaki 1C specijalista naišao na situaciju potrebe za prenosom podataka iz jedne informativne baze na drugu. U slučaju kada su konfiguracije različite, morate pisati pravila pretvorbe podataka. Ova se pravila kreiraju u konfiguraciji podataka 1c "".

Takođe, podaci se mogu prenijeti pomoću. Mnoge konfiguracije 1c 8.3 Postoji tipična funkcionalnost za konfiguriranje sinkronizacije podataka između različitih konfiguracija i bešavne integracije s 1C protokom dokumenata.

Ali kada se podaci moraju prenijeti između apsolutno identičnih konfiguracija, možete pojednostaviti zadatak i koristiti standardni prijenos i preuzeti obradu putem XML-a. Imajte na umu da ova metoda, kao i pretvorba podataka, uspoređuje objekte preko jedinstvenog identifikatora (GUID), a ne po imenu.

Ovu obradu možete preuzeti na njen disk ili referencom:

Univerzalno je i pogodno za bilo koju konfiguraciju.

Razmotrite primjer istovara priručnika "nomenklatura" iz jedne informativne baze 1C 8.3 računovodstva 3.0 na drugu. Obavezno stanje Bit će selekcija roditelja (grupa) "drvorije".

Prijenos podataka sa 1c u XML

Idite na bazu informacija, odakle će se istovariti podaci (izvor). Obavezno ih provjerite, predviđaju se za sve moguće uvjete kako bi se izbjegla pojavu nepoželjnih posljedica.

Otvorite prijenos i utovar i preuzimanje XML podataka (Ctrl + O).

Zainteresovani smo za karticu "Istovar". Prije svega, navedite ime datoteke na koju će se podaci i staza za uštede biti istovareni. U ovaj slučaj Podaci se istovaruju "u datoteku na poslužitelju".

U prerađivačkoj kapi, period u kojem će se izvesti odabir. Također, za periodične registre možete odrediti metodu za korištenje odabira po periodu. Ako trebate istovariti pokrete zajedno s dokumentima, odgovarajuća zastava je postavljena. U ovom slučaju preopterećujemo direktorij, tako da ne trebate ništa postavljati u zaglavlju.

Okrenite se odabiru podataka za istovar. U tabeli dijela obrasca za obradu odaberite konfiguracijske objekte koji su vam potrebni za prenošenje zastava.

Stupac "istovari ako je potrebno" znači da li je potrebno preopteretiti ovaj objektAko se odnosi na referiranje referentne knjige preklapajući se. Na primjer, položaj preopterećenja nomenklature ima takvu mjernu jedinicu koja nije u bazi podataka. Ako ispred referentne knjige sa mjernim jedinicama, zastava u stupcu "Istovar, ako je potrebno" stvorit će novu poziciju. U suprotnom, jer će vrijednost rekviziti biti natpis "<Объект не найден>"I njegov jedinstveni identifikator.

U jednostavnom slučaju, bez odabira, podešavanje preopterećenja nomenklature izgledaće ovako.

U ovom primjeru, trebate samo odabrati nomenklaturu koja se nalazi u mapi za obradu drveta.

Slična obrada za 8.2 omogućava vam instaliranje odabira u prikladan obrazac za svaki konfiguracijski objekt. U 8.3, nažalost, ne postoji takav funkcionalan. Jedna od mogućnosti za izlaz u ovoj situaciji bit će odabir potrebnih pozicija na kartici "Dodatni objekti za istovar".

Ovdje možete dodati predmete kao ručno (gumb "Dodaj") i upit ("dodajte zahtjev ..."). Sa svojom velikom količinom, druga opcija je poželjna.

U ovom slučaju, zahtjev će biti sljedeći. Ispunite postavke, izvršite zahtjev provjerom podataka i kliknite na gumb "Select Rezultat".

Nakon što navedete sve potrebne objekte i dodatne elemente za istovar, kliknite na gumb Podaci za prijenos podataka. Oni će pasti u XML datoteku, naziv i put koji su naznačeni ranije. Rezultati ove operacije bit će prikazani u porukama.

U ovom primjeru bilo je potrebno istovariti samo 3 položaja, ali pet istovarenih. Sve jer ispred priručnika "nomenklatura" u stupcu "Istovar ako je potrebno", instalirana je zastava. Zajedno s pravim pozicijama, njihovi roditelji su preopterećeni.

Preuzmite imenik iz XML

Nakon uspješno istovara podataka iz konfiguracije - izvor u XML datoteci otvorite bazu podataka - prijemnik. Struktura objekata i njihovi detalji trebaju se podudarati jedni s drugima. U ovom slučaju, transfer se vrši između dvije standardne konfiguracije 1c: Računovodstvo 3.0.

Otvorite obradu u bazi podataka. Ovaj tretman Koristi se i za istovar i preuzimanje podataka. Kliknite karticu Preuzimanje i navedite put do XML datotekaU kojem su podaci prethodno istovareni. Nakon toga kliknite na gumb za prenos podataka.

Rezultat preuzimanja bit će prikazan u porukama. U našem slučaju sve je bilo uspješno.

Priručnik "Nomenklatura" u bazi podataka nije bila popunjena. Sada ima pet elemenata: tri nomenklaturne položaje i dvije grupe.

14.06.2018 13:04:27 1c: Posluživanjeruž

Uvođenje

Programi 1C su univerzalna rješenja za pohranu važnih podataka i njihovu obradu. Direktoriji, časopisi i dokumenti su samo školjke za lak pristup podacima i vezama između njih. Često postoji potreba za istovaranjem tih podataka iz 1c. Ciljevi mogu biti drugačiji - istovar za razmjenu s drugim 1C programima, istovar za banku, istovar podataka u datoteke različitih formata itd.

U ovom ćemo članku razmotriti osnovne mogućnosti istovara podataka sa 1C 8.3 računovodstva i problema koji se mogu susresti.

Prijenos podataka iz 1C u Excel, Word, PDF, MXL datoteke i druge

Da biste istovarili podatke iz 1C u datoteke različitog formata, morate učiniti sljedeće.

Otvorite isprazni dokument. Može biti bankovna naloga, dokumenti prihoda (njihovi Štampani obrasci), Izvještaji, časopisi, reverzni saldori i još mnogo toga.

Na primjer, razmotrite izjavu o radu. Otvaranje, kliknite ikonu diskete na desnom gornjem dijelu programa.

Pažnja: Ako ikona diskete nije dostupna, pokušajte kliknuti na bilo koji polje izvještaja. Ovo je neophodno da izveštaj "aktivno".

Nakon klika, otvorit će se sljedeći prozor:

U njemu možete odabrati lokaciju datoteke, unesite njegovo ime i odaberite format. Najčešće se koristi: DOCX (Word), XLSX (Excel), PDF (PDF), TXT, MXL i drugi.

U ovom primjeru ćemo izabrati excel format 2007. i sačuvajte datoteku u mapi.

Ovako je sačuvana izjava o radu:

Kao što se vidi, izvještaji se spremaju u prilično prikladan i pristupačan oblik sa uštedom svih podataka i formatiranja.

Dakle, istovarivanjem potrebnih podataka iz 1C-a, mogu se premjestiti odvojeno od baze. Na primjer, možete poslati e-poštom. Kolega pošte (umjesto da prenosi cijelu bazu), možete ih sačuvati prije promjena u samom programu ili jednostavno ispisane.

Istovar lista iz 1C u Excel, Word, PDF, MXL datoteke i druge

Ponekad postoji potreba za istovaranjem popisa dokumenata, a ne sami dokument, dok u režimu pregleda liste, ikona diskete nije dostupna. Da biste istovarili podatke takve strukture, prvo morate pošaliti listu u tabelarnom obliku, nakon čega se već može sačuvati.

Kao primjer, razmislite o popisu nalozi za plaćanje. Da biste ga istovarili, pogledajte meni više - prikažite listu:

U prozoru koji se otvara, možete odrediti polja koja će biti predstavljena na popisu:

Sve ćemo ostaviti bez promjene, kliknite na U redu. Kao rezultat toga, lista je predstavljena kao tablica. Sada nećemo biti puno teško da ga istovarimo baš dok smo istekli dokument ranije. Kliknite na disketu, odaberite lokaciju, ime i format i sačuvajte datoteku:

Prijenos podataka sa 1C 8.3 Računovodstvo na ostale programe

Za razmjenu podataka s drugim programima 1S, morate omogućiti sinkronizaciju podataka. To možete učiniti u meniju administracije - sinhronizacija podataka.

Ako Checkmark Sinhronizacija nije aktivna (kao na donjoj slici) - Vaša baza nije konfigurirana za sinkronizaciju s drugim 1C bazama podataka. Nažalost, razmatranje postavljanja sinhronizacije izvan je opsega ovog članka, pa ćemo se ograničiti na ovu mogućnost.

Ako sinhronizujete bazu podataka 1c sa drugom bazom podataka, bit ćete dostupni funkciji razmjene podataka koji djeluje najčešće u automatskom režimu.

Za bilo kakva pitanja o uspostavljanju sinhronizacije i razmjene podataka između baza podataka možete se obratiti našim menadžerima, što će u okviru besplatne savjetovanja odgovoriti na sva vaša pitanja.

U 1C računovodstvu postoji vrlo pogodna prilika za razmjenu dokumenata sa bankama. To se radi istovarnim / učitavanjem podataka. Kada odredite potrebne bankovne dokumente, istovarite ih u datoteku, a zatim u bankarskom sustavu učitajte ga, a nakon obrade dokumenata bit će dostupni u bankarskom sustavu za ponovnu provjeru i provođenje.

Za istovar sa 1C 8.3 Računovodstvene dokumente za slanje u banku Idite na popis dokumenata i kliknite gumb za slanje u banku

Odabir željenog perioda, odredite dokumente za istovar, a zatim kliknite datoteku da biste istovarili u banku na dnu ekrana:

U prozoru koji se otvori odaberite lokaciju datoteke. Nakon toga možete preuzeti ovu datoteku u bankarskom sistemu.

Prijenos podataka sa 1C 8.3 Računovodstvo za razmjenu sa bankom

Zaključno, želio bih napomenuti da 1c pruža sve potrebni alati Za jednostavno I. brzo istovar Podaci iz baze podataka i održavaju ih u najčešćim formatima.

Imate pitanja? Pomoći ćemo u ispuštanju podataka iz 1C kao dio besplatne konsultacije!

Načini rada

Rukovanje luggageloadsDataxml82 implementira 2 načina rada: Istovar (kreiranje datoteke za preuzimanje podataka koje je odredio korisnik) i preuzimanja (čitanje datoteke istovara kreiranim u IT-u) i zabilježite podatke u IT-u). Postavljanje načina rada vrši se odabirom u polje načina rada.

Prije pokretanja režima ili drugog režima (pritiskom na tipku RUN) morate odrediti naziv datoteke istovara ili ručno unošenjem u polje "Naziv datoteke" ili pomoću ovog polja Odaberite taster i dijalog standardnog odabira datoteke .

U režimu preuzimanja moguće je uređivati \u200b\u200bupotrebu ishoda prilikom snimanja registara, koji mogu utjecati na brzinu preuzimanja. "Onemogući" tipke "i" Omogući rezultate "dostupni su kada" omogući mogućnost uređivanja upotrebe ishoda tokom opterećenja podataka "i koristi se za ručna kontrola Način za korištenje ishoda prilikom učitavanja podataka. ** Uslovi za primjenjivost obrade **

Obrada se može koristiti samo u slučajevima kada su podaci u kojoj se podaci istovaruju i podaci u kojima se učitavaju podaci su homogeni (konfiguracije su identične, podaci mogu varirati) ili su svi istovareni objekti gotovo u potpunosti u kompoziciji i Vrste detalja i tabelarni dijelovi, svojstva "olovnog" predmeta metapodataka itd. Treba napomenuti da je zbog ograničenja prerada uglavnom namijenjena razmjeni između homogenog IB-a.

Format istovara datoteke razlikuje se od format datoteke kreiran prilikom istovara u skladu s planom razmjene, dio zaglavlja. Za prijenos podataka (elementi referentnih knjiga, registara itd.) Obrada se koristi isti mehanizam za serizam XML, koji se istovaruje po planovima razmjene, formati datoteka su identični u ovom dijelu.

Definicija učitavanja

Obrada vam omogućava da izvršite potpuno i djelomično istovar podataka podataka o podacima u datoteku. Postavljanje sastava otpuštenih podataka vrši se u dijalogu postavljanjem zastava u stupcu stabla koji prikazuju objekte metapodataka koji se mogu objaviti. Dodatni stupac zastava, "ako je potrebno", uspostavlja potrebu za istovaranjem objekata ovaj tip "veza". To jest, ako se potvrdni okvir instalira samo u "Ako je potrebno", tada se podaci o takvom objektu neće u potpunosti istovariti, već samo u jačini koji je potreban za održavanje referentnog integriteta u bazi podataka, koja će se preuzeti the Tyom Gield.

Kada otvorite obrazac, obrada uspostavlja znak istovara na vezu na sve objekte koji garantuje referentni integritet neopterećenog fragmenta informatičke baze.

Kada kliknete na gumb "Define Objects Neplod", analize obrade, reference na koje se podaci mogu sadržavati u predmetima koji imaju znak potpunog istovara i automatski ispunjavaju stupac zastava koji ukazuje na potrebu da se popne. Ako objekt već ima već potpunu zastavu istovara, u tom slučaju ne postavlja se utovarivačka FLARU.

Moguće aplikacije

Korištenje ove obrade moguće je, na primjer, stvoriti potpunu ili djelomičnu izradu sigurnosnih kopija podataka, izrada razmjene podataka između baza podataka, kao i pomoćnog alata prilikom vraćanja baza podataka o problemima.